(PPS) first and then the … log in bank of america credit cardWebMar 1, 2024 · The 2024 TSP contribution limit for employee deferrals is $22,500, a nearly 10% increase from the $20,500 limit in 2024. The IRS caps catch-up contributions at $7,500 in 2024, a $1,000 increase over the last three years.
